Are uncirculated coins better than proof coins?

When it comes to collecting and investing in coins, there are two main types that often come to mind: uncirculated coins and proof coins. So, the question is, are uncirculated coins truly better than proof coins? Let's delve into the differences and consider the pros and cons of each to help us make an informed decision. Uncirculated coins, often referred to as 'mint state' coins, are coins that have never been used in circulation and have been carefully preserved since they left the mint. They typically feature sharp details, clean surfaces, and a high level of preservation. On the other hand, proof coins are struck using a special process that results in a mirror-like finish on the coin's surface and frosted, raised details. These coins are typically produced in limited quantities and are often sought after by collectors for their unique appearance and rarity. But, is one inherently better than the other? It ultimately depends on personal preference and the specific goals of the collector. Uncirculated coins may be a more practical choice for investors looking for a more affordable entry point into the market, while proof coins may appeal to collectors who prioritize rarity and aesthetic appeal. Ultimately, the decision between uncirculated and proof coins comes down to individual taste and the collector's specific collecting goals.

Are circulated coins better than uncirculated coins?

Are circulated coins truly superior to their uncirculated counterparts? It's a question that has sparked much debate among collectors and investors alike. On one hand, circulated coins have a unique charm and history, having been passed from hand to hand over the years. They often bear signs of wear and tear, adding to their character and authenticity. On the other hand, uncirculated coins are pristine and untouched, retaining their original mint luster and value. So, which is better? It ultimately depends on personal preference and investment goals. Circulated coins may offer a more affordable entry point for collectors, while uncirculated coins may appreciate in value over time. Ultimately, the decision is yours to make.
